## Local Setup — Cron Drift Probe

Clone the repo, run `make bootstrap`, then start the Tickwarden scheduler shim. We're chasing drift between the Fenner cron host and the Opaline job queue, so timestamps matter — sync your clock first. Logs land in `./drift/`. The probe needs read access to the jobs table. Point it at the staging database using the connection string below.

replica DSN, kajep-yahag: mssql://praok_svc:iF@db-8d68.plorvaio.local:5432/eliion

Subject: Quickstore 4.2 — bloom filter now fronts the KV layer

Plugin authors: starting with this release, Quickstore places a bloom filter ahead of the key-value store. Negative lookups return faster; false positives fall through safely. No API changes are required on your side. Verify your plugin against the staging build referenced below.

session token of fahif-tadup = htk3_9c7

### Relevance tuning — support notes

When customers report odd search rankings on Findery, first confirm whether the synonym pack shipped last Tuesday is active for their tenant; most complaints trace back to aggressive stemming there. Do not edit boost weights directly — log the ticket and apply the pre-approved tuning profile via the RankForge console instead. Re-indexing takes up to twenty minutes, so set expectations. The RankForge tuning endpoint authenticates with the internal support key, which follows below.

gateway credential: kto3_qfe

Scanwright plugin authors: the barcode scanner integration exposes a single event bus. Your plugin subscribes to decoded symbols; raw frames are not available. Supported symbologies: Code 128, EAN-13, QR. Decode latency budget is 40ms — exceed it and Scanwright drops your handler for that scan. Register via the manifest, declare symbologies explicitly, and never block the bus thread. Sandbox credentials come with your contract packet. The full event schema and test harness are documented on the internal page below.

wiki page, tahaf-tajog: https://jira.ordindyn.corp/pipeline